Mechatronics apprenticeship

Clitheroe
Posted: 13 February
Offer description

Kindeva is a global pharmaceutical contract developer and manufacturer (CDMO) business, where we combine life enhancing drugs with state-of-the-art inhalers to provide customers and patients, with top quality respiratory devices. Our role as a Contract Manufacturer is one, we are incredibly proud of and is one which allows us to be at the forefront of new manufacturing technologies and processes, bringing lifesaving products to patients worldwide. Due to significant changes in the marketplace Kindeva is currently going through a period of substantial growth and we are looking for talented individuals to join our Clitheroe team. Role Overview: In this role you will carry out planned, preventative and reactive maintenance on mechanical/electrical control systems, within a pharmaceutical environment, and have the aptitude and desire to undertake a 4-year apprenticeship. The successful applicant will spend the first year in full-time education at the approved training provider, with block placements onsite at Kindeva. Subsequent years will be day release at the training provider. Key responsibilities include, but are not limited to: Follow / adhere to Kindeva’s Health and Safety and Environmental Policy Work within a Regulatory working environment. Maintain Mechanical / PLC Control Systems, HMI Systems and Vision Systems tailored to the pharmaceutical Environment. Maintain and repair the equipment to validated specification. Evaluate breakdowns and stoppages and communicate in a timely manner. Demonstrate sound fault-finding diagnostic ability (Use fault finding tools i.e. Fishbone 5 Whys C&E etc.) Identify root cause and provide solutions to issues working with relevant resources to resolve. Maintain equipment and assets in a safe, compliant, and reliable order. Complete and maintain GMP documentation in line with Current Good Manufacturing Practice. Coach and promote “Best Engineering Practices” within work group. Skills & Experience: GCSE or equivalent; a minimum of 3 including Maths & English at grade 5 or above is essential. GCSE or equivalent in an engineering or technical subject desirable. Key Capabilities: Good organisational, interpersonal, and time management skills. Enthusiastic, flexible, conscientious and proactive in approach. To work efficiently with supervision. Take a positive approach to own training and development. Good communication skills. Strong team player. Training to be provided: L2 Diploma in Advanced Manufacturing (Foundation Competence). L3 Diploma in Advanced Manufacturing Engineering (Development Competencies) Mechatronics Maintenance Technician. L3 Diploma or Extended Diploma in Advanced Manufacturing Engineering (Development Knowledge). Functional skills in English, Maths and ICT (if not already achieved).
